Thunder Group 5307AR 32 Oz 6.8 Inch Asian Rose Melamine Round Swirl Bowl, DZ FEATURES & TECHNICAL SPECIFICATIONS

Thunder Group 5307AR 32 Oz 6 7/8 Inch Asian Rose Melamine Round Swirl Bowl, DZ is perfect for serving sliced fruits, salads with fresh or marinated vegetables, noodles, rice-based dishes and other items of Asian cuisine for a whole table to share.

This 32 Oz bowl has a swirled design that makes it looks more stylish and aesthetically pleasing.

Manufactured from a durable plastic material this swirl bowl is popular for its nearly unbreakable structure. However, with its heat resistance of up to 212°F melamine is not suitable for cooking in an oven or heating in a microwave.

Melamine bowls by Thunder Group is a practical solution for catered indoor and outdoor events.

The Rose collection has a distinctively stylish appearance and elegant presentation with its floral pattern on a snow-white base. Featuring rose, yellow, blue and light green Asian Rose dinnerware designed to resemble fine china. Items from this collection suit not only Asian-themed restaurants or catered events but also all other food-serving establishments that choose eye-pleasing and affordable tableware.

It is dishwasher safe. BPA free, non-toxic, NSF approved.
